Highcharts を利用したグラフを描画するとき、動的に後からグラフデータを追加したい場合がある。 通常の描画の仕方はこう。 chart = Highcharts.Chart({ chart: { anything... type: 'line' // 折れ線グラフ }, anything... // ここからグラフデータ series: [{ name: '1本目', data: [1, 2.5, 2] }, { name: '2本目', data: [1.5, 2, 3.5] }] }); これに、何か特定のイベントが発生したときにもう一本折れ線グラフを追加したいという場合、下のように Highcharts.Chart オブジェクトの addSeries でグラフデータを追加することができる。 chart.addSeries({ name: '3本目', data: [1.75,
I'm using D3 to generate a bar chart (I adapted the code from this example). The labels I'm using on the x-axis are a couple of words long each, and since this makes all of the labels overlap I need to break these labels across lines. (It'll be fine if I can replace all of the spaces in each label with newlines.) I originally tried this by replacing the spaces with literal newlines (
) and set
There isn't an attribute for text wrapping, but there is a simple trick you can use. Add one word at a time to a text object and when it gets too wide, add a line feed. You can use the getBBox() function to determine the width. Basically, you emulate an old fashioned typewriter. Here is a sample of some code that will do this for you. You could easily turn this into a simple function that takes th
The most popular coding language for the web is javascript; so much so that since the advent of HTML5, it has now been officially accepted as the default standard. Javascript has moved beyond a smaller client-side browser-based language to become integrated not just for front-end design, but also for back-end server-side development. As a result there are has been a huge growth of Javascript libra
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く